Conquering Katahdin

Standing tall as the highest peak in Maine, Mount Katahdin presents a challenging ascent for even the seasoned hikers. The trail is a rugged path through forested terrain, offering majestic views at every turn. As you climb higher, the air becomes colder, and the sprawling landscape unfolds before your eyes. The summit itself is a triumphant destination, marking the culmination of your adventure.

The sense of pride upon reaching the top is indescribable, leaving you with memories that will last a lifetime. Be aware that this is not an easy hike, so be prepared for all weather conditions and pack plenty of sustenance. Safety should always be your top consideration, so let someone know your intentions before you depart.

Red Rock Country's Red Rock Trails: A Hiker's Paradise

Sedona, Arizona is renowned for its breathtaking red rock formations that create a landscape unlike any other. The area boasts an impressive network of trails catering to hikers of all experiencies. Whether you're wanting a difficult ascent or a relaxed stroll, you'll find the ideal trail in Sedona.

From gorgeous views to historic petroglyphs, the trails offer a diverse range of experiences. As you trek through the colorful sandstone canyons, you'll be profoundly immersed in nature's magnificence.

Several popular trails include:

* Bell Rock Trail

* West Fork Mesa Trail

* Boynton Canyon Vista Trail

No matter your choice, Sedona's red rock trails are a must-visit destination for any nature lover.
